Project scheduling and tracking in software engineering pdf




















Concerned compatibility of strategies with the organizational with developing team communication and reporting achievement. Banks and insurance companies employ procedures, job assignments and roles, project change procedure, and how project funding and project managers for the implementation of new billing will be handled. In short, the progress and 5. Establishing the project management environment development of organizations in several industries is and workbook.

Focuses on the collection and being explained by the use of project management. Planning the Project The project management techniques related to the Project managers make sure the cost lie within the project planning phase include: estimated value and there is no wastage of resources in the production processes. Describing project scope, alternatives, and feasibility. Some relevant questions The project workbook is the primary source of that should be answered include: information for producing all project reports.

Communicating the project status. This means that address? Divide the project into tasks. This technique is also Closing Down the Project known as the work breakdown structure. This step is The project management techniques related to the done to ensure an easy progression between tasks. Estimating resources and creating a resource plan. This helps to gather and arrange resources in 1. Closing down the project. In this stage, it is the most effective manner.

Developing a preliminary schedule. In this step, you completion of the project. Also, all project are to assign time estimates to each activity in the documentation and records should be finalized so work breakdown structure. From here, you will be that the final review of the project can be conducted.

Conducting post project reviews. This is done to project. Developing a communication plan. The idea here is deliverables, the processes used to create them, and to outline the communication procedures between the project management process.

Closing the customer contract. The final activity is 6. Determining project standards and procedures. The to ensure that all contractual terms of the project specification of how various deliverables are have been met. Identifying and assessing risk. The goal here is to The techniques listed above in the four key phases of identify potential sources of risk and the project management enable a project team to: consequences of those risks.

Creating a preliminary budget. Developing a statement of work. Setting a baseline project plan. Establish a dependable project control and Executing the Project monitoring system. The project management techniques related to the project execution phase include: Tools 1.

Executing the baseline project plan. The job of the Project management is a challenging task with many project manager is to initiate the execution of project complex responsibilities. Fortunately, there are many activities, acquire and assign resources; orient and tools available to assist with accomplishing the tasks and train new team members, keep the project on executing the responsibilities.

Some require a computer schedule, and assure the quality of project with supporting software, while others can be used deliverables. Project managers should choose a project 2. Monitoring project progress against the baseline management tool that best suits their management style. Gantt Charts are two of the most commonly used project 3. Managing changes to the baseline project plan. Both of 4. Maintaining the project workbook. Maintaining these project management tools can be produced complete records of all project events is necessary.

Specify the Individual Activities: From the work management software. This listing can be used as CPM - Critical Path Method the basis for adding sequence and duration information in later steps. In , DuPont developed a project management method designed to address the challenge of shutting 2. Determine the Sequence of the Activities: Some down chemical plants for maintenance and then activities are dependent on the completion of others.

Shows which activities are critical to maintaining the schedule and which are not. Estimate Activity Completion Time: The time required to complete each activity can be estimated CPM models the activities and events of a project as a using past experience or the estimates of network. Activities are depicted as nodes on the network knowledgeable persons. CPM is a deterministic and events that signify the beginning or ending of model that does not take into account variation in activities are depicted as arcs or lines between the nodes.

CPM Diagram 5. Identify the Critical Path The critical path is the longest-duration path through the network. The significance of the critical path is that the activities that lie on it cannot be delayed without delaying the project.

Because of its impact on the entire project, critical path analysis is an important aspect of project planning. The critical path can be identified by determining the following four parameters for each activity: ES - earliest start time: the earliest time at which the Steps in CPM Project Planning activity can start given that its precedent activities must be completed first.

Specify the individual activities. EF - earliest finish time, equal to the earliest start time Determine the sequence of those activities. Draw a network diagram. LF - latest finish time: the latest time at which the Estimate the completion time for each activity. Identify the critical path longest path through the LS - Latest start time, equal to the latest finish time network minus the time required to complete the activity. Update the CPM diagram as the project progresses.

The slack time for an activity is the time between its earliest and latest start time, or between its earliest and latest finish time. In a project, an activity is a task that must be performed The critical path is the path through the project network and an event is a milestone marking the completion of in which none of the activities have slack, that is, the one or more activities.

Project the path. A delay in the critical path delays the project. PERT originally was anactivity on reduce the total time required for the activities in the arc network, in which the activities are represented on critical path. Over time, some people began to use PERT as an activity on 6. Update CPM Diagram node network. For this discussion, we will use the original form of activity on arc. Software project management comprises of a number of activities, which contains planning of project, deciding scope of software product, estimation of cost in various terms, scheduling of tasks and events, and resource management.

Project management activities may include:. Software project planning is task, which is performed before the production of software actually starts. It is there for the software production but involves no concrete activity that has any direction connection with software production; rather it is a set of multiple processes, which facilitates software production.

Project planning may include the following:. It defines the scope of project; this includes all the activities, process need to be done in order to make a deliverable software product. Scope management is essential because it creates boundaries of the project by clearly defining what would be done in the project and what would not be done.

This makes project to contain limited and quantifiable tasks, which can easily be documented and in turn avoids cost and time overrun. For an effective management accurate estimation of various measures is a must.

With correct estimation managers can manage and control the project more efficiently and effectively. Lines of code depend upon coding practices and Function points vary according to the user or software requirement. The managers estimate efforts in terms of personnel requirement and man-hour required to produce the software.

For effort estimation software size should be known. Once size and efforts are estimated, the time required to produce the software can be estimated. Efforts required is segregated into sub categories as per the requirement specifications and interdependency of various components of software. The tasks are scheduled on day-to-day basis or in calendar months. The sum of time required to complete all tasks in hours or days is the total time invested to complete the project.

This might be considered as the most difficult of all because it depends on more elements than any of the previous ones. For estimating project cost, it is required to consider -. We discussed various parameters involving project estimation such as size, effort, time and cost. This technique uses empirically derived formulae to make estimation. This model is made by Lawrence H. Putnam model maps time and efforts required with software size.

It divides the software product into three categories of software: organic, semi-detached and embedded. Project Scheduling in a project refers to roadmap of all activities to be done with specified order and within time slot allotted to each activity.

Project managers tend to define various tasks, and project milestones and arrange them keeping various factors in mind. They look for tasks lie in critical path in the schedule, which are necessary to complete in specific manner because of task interdependency and strictly within the time allocated. Arrangement of tasks which lies out of critical path are less likely to impact over all schedule of the project.

For scheduling a project, it is necessary to -. All elements used to develop a software product may be assumed as resource for that project. This may include human resource, productive tools and software libraries.

The resources are available in limited quantity and stay in the organization as a pool of assets. The shortage of resources hampers the development of project and it can lag behind the schedule. Allocating extra resources increases development cost in the end. It is therefore necessary to estimate and allocate adequate resources for the project. The user can also book an appointment doing payment through a debit card. They can also make changes in the appointment schedule i.

This software will help the company to be more efficient in the registration of their patients and manage appointments, records of patients. It enables doctors and admin to view and modify appointment schedules if required. The purpose of this project is to computerize all details regarding patient details and hospital details. The project is an authentication system that validates users for accessing the system only when they input the correct password.

The project involves three levels of user authentication. There are varieties of password systems available, many of which have failed due to bot attacks while few have sustained it but to a limit. In short, almost all the passwords available today can be broken to a limit. Hence this project is aimed to achieve the highest security in authenticating users. The Online Complaint Portal web application is intended to allow the Citizen of India to express his problems to the government authorities.

Through this, a citizen can file complaints regarding any area in Delhi. Then the complaint is forwarded to the government officials.

The officer then can resolve that complaint and then give a confirmation to the citizen through our site. Thus it will act as an interface between the government and the citizens. The main aim of this project is to develop the software for the process of booking events and movies which should lead to increased efficiency and reduced drawbacks which were present in the previous procedure of online ticket booking and make it convenient for the customer to book a particular ticket.

The software should control redundancy so that no two customers can access the same seat at the same time and transactions should be independent. Moreover, ticket booking has been a hassle for the customer, they are left with just an option i. The technical system is fast, accurate, informative, reliable, and user-friendly.

The proposed system enables the customer to do things such as the search for movies that are available on a specified date for a particular venue. The system displays all the movie details such as price, duration, venue, time, date.

Using the navigate option the user can enter his position or simply switch on his GPS on mobile to know the nearest metro station in the vicinity. Using the fare calculator option we can know the distance, time, routes, and fare between any two metro stations. Using the settings option, the user can enable his device to indicate various updates available on this application, etc.

Further, as a special function, the application allows the user to avail of different offers at the time of online payment. The Online Missing Person Information System is a web application that is intended to allow the citizens of India to report any missing person to the government authorities. The application will act as an interface between the government authorities and the citizen of India.

Through this web application, the citizens of India can file any missing person from any area. Then the case is assigned to the government from that area.



0コメント

  • 1000 / 1000